The Fat Kat is a new (not "brand new" as in "Papillon", but "new", as in "less than a coupla months old") BYOB restaurant on Main Street in Little Ferry, South of Rte 46.

Go there for lunch or dinner. The Chef, Antonio Goodman, is a young turk with credentials from some of North Jersey's nicest eateries. The place is small, and reservations are a good idea.

Just don't confuse Little Ferry with Little Falls, or you'll never find the place.
